More about the book
Exploring the intricate relationship between eighteenth-century British women writers and India, this book delves into their novels and travel writings. It highlights how these authors navigated and responded to colonial discourse, revealing a multifaceted space shaped by their experiences and perspectives. Through historical context, the work examines the unique contributions of these women to literature and their complex engagement with the themes of colonization and identity.
